So in total you have a sketch, a theme and the option of adding a bookmark or tag.  Well I was definitely up for the challenge.  The only set I thought I could use was the retired SU Apple of My Eye - well apples are for teachers are they not?  I'd love to know where that idea originated!


I used a piece of SU Designer Series Paper for one of my side panels, the other I stamped some of the leaves from the set in SU Pear Pizazz.  I added a stitched framelit of the DSP for the back of my apple and stamped the image and the words on another stitched framelit.  The leaves and stalk were cut out and inked in SU Tranquil Tide and finished off with Wink of Stella.  I used some of the lovely SU Satin ribbon and a diamond embellishment to finish off my card.  Inside the card is a bookmark,  which easily slides off the card ready to be attached to a book.




The sentiment inside is from another old SU set Build A Bouquet - well maybe the teachers are not quite so happy to be back after their break!
